MONO COUNTY, Calif. (Nov. 12, 2021) —  A fatal crash on Highway 395 happened Friday morning when a pickup and trailer overturned near Deadman Summit in Mono County.

The traffic accident happened about 5:06 a.m. on Nov. 12th, according to the California Highway Patrol.

Traffic Accident on US 395 at Deadman Summit

The CHP reported the driver of a Ford F-250 pickup truck pulling a trailer loaded with firewood crashed and the vehicle and trailer overturned in the roadway. It’s unknown how many vehicles collided at this time, but both vehicles had blown out tires. Police say firewood and other debris from the trailer blocked the roadway.

At least one person died in the collision, but there are no further details provided in the CHP report at this time. Authorities closed down the southbound lanes of Highway 395 in front of the Deadman sledding area.

Investigators seek to determine fault for the crash.
